Pluronics, also known as poloxamers, are a class of synthetic block copolymers which consist of hydrophilic poly (ethylene oxide) (PEO) and hydrophobic poly (propylene oxide) (PPO), arranged in an A-B-A triblock structure, thus giving PEO-PPO-PEO …

Pluronics are amphiphilic triblock copolymers composed of two hydrophilic poly (ethylene oxide) (PEO) chains linked via a central hydrophobic polypropylene oxide (PPO). Owing to their low molecular weight polymer and greater number of PEO segments, Pluronics induce micelle formation and gelation at critical micelle concentrations and temperatures.
